揭秘企业级软件开发服务,用什么技术,如何选择最佳方案

教程 2025-03-26 1686 0
随着科技的飞速发展,软件开发服务已经成为企业提升核心竞争力的重要手段,在众多的软件开发服务中,如何选择合适的技术和方案,成为了企业面临的一大难题,本文将为您揭秘企业级软件开发服务,探讨用什么技术,如何选择最佳方案,企业级软件开发服务概述企业级软件开发服务是指针对企业客户需求,提供定制化的软件开发解决方案的服务……...

随着科技的飞速进步,软件开发服务已成为企业提升核心竞争力的关键武器,在众多软件开发服务中,如何挑选最适合的技术和策略,成为企业面临的一大挑战,本文将深入解析企业级软件开发服务,探讨其技术选型与最佳方案的甄选策略。

企业级软件开发服务旨在满足企业独特的需求,提供定制化的解决方案,服务内容通常包括需求分析、系统设计、开发、测试、部署和维护等关键环节,通过提高工作效率、降低成本和增强竞争力,为企业长远发展注入强大动力。

揭秘企业级软件开发服务,用什么技术,如何选择最佳方案,揭秘企业级软件开发服务,用什么技术,如何选择最佳方案,企业级技术选型,方案评估,用什么软件开发服务,第1张

技术选型指南

编程语言

在软件开发的基础层面,编程语言的选择至关重要,以下是一些广泛应用的编程语言:

  • Java:凭借其卓越的跨平台性和稳定性,在大型企业级应用中备受青睐。
  • C#:在Windows平台上表现出色,拥有丰富的库支持。
  • Python:快速开发和庞大的社区支持使其成为众多创新项目的首选。
  • JavaScript:在Web前端开发中展现出跨平台特性和活跃的开发者社群,颇具优势。

开发框架

开发框架能显著提升开发效率,是提升项目质量的重要工具:

  • Spring Boot(针对Java应用):强大的社区支持和丰富的库资源使其备受推崇。
  • .NET Core(适用于C#):展现出出色的跨平台性能和可靠性。
  • Django(针对Python应用):高度可扩展的社区和大量功能库简化开发流程。
  • React、Vue.js:在Web前端开发中展现出卓越的性能和丰富的组件库。

数据库技术

选择恰当的数据库技术对于项目的成功至关重要:

  • 关系型数据库(如MySQL、Oracle、SQL Server等):适用于存储结构化的数据。
  • 非关系型数据库(如MongoDB、Redis等):更适合处理非结构化数据。

项目管理策略与优化方案

云计算技术

云计算技术对企业降本增效的影响不言而喻,以下是一些主流云服务商:

  • 阿里云、腾讯云、华为云:提供包含云服务器、云数据库和云存储在内的系列服务,促进企业数字化转型。

方案甄选策略

  • 需求分析:实施全方位考量,明确业务需求,精准把握技术需求和成本预算,为后续决策提供依据。
  • 技术选型:基于需求分析结果及企业技术实力和资源,挑选合适的编程语言、开发框架与数据库技术。
  • 项目管理:采用高效的项目管理工具和方法,如敏捷开发与Scrum,确保项目顺利推进。
  • 团队协作:组建经验丰富的开发团队,确保项目质量与进度同步前行。
  • 成本控制:在实施过程中严格监督成本支出,明晰预算分配策略,避免产生不必要的开销。
  • 持续优化:确保项目上线后系统性能、功能与用户体验持续优化升级,满足企业长远需求。

借助详尽的需求分析、技术手段的恰当选取及全面的项目管理与优化策略,企业能够精准找到最适合自己的软件开发服务方案,助力企业的数字化转型之路迈出新步伐。

版权声明:如发现本站有侵权违规内容,请发送邮件至yrdown@88.com举报,一经核实,将第一时间删除。

发布评论

支付宝
微信
文章目录
温馨提示

因疑似有违规内容,本站CDN等服务暂停使用,违规内容排查中,如需下载,请使用其他网盘链接。